Trivandrum Speciality.
For those who does not know about Trivandrum.
Trivandrum is the capital city of Kerala (Gods Own Country), an integral part of Indian tourism destination. This place is currently one of the best place to live, in India. The city is currently having a high status of being the twin city of Barcelona, Spain. The people who live in this city are mostly government servants, IT specialists and has a mixed culture of many other professions and cultures.
Dining out here is one of the major challenges I have faced, during all these years since I was in my teens. But the city has some outlets which provide some real experience you can never forget. Today, I am taking my readers to a zone of real taste. This outlet is supposed to be one of the oldest in town.
Rahmanya, is one of the places where you can have some real feel of chicken specialty. Unlike the other places which many of us have visited for good food, this place is unique for the kind of food which is served there. The specialties are extended through the day from 11:00 am to 9:00 pm. So lets see what is so special out here?
Chicken Speciality
The chicken preparation out here is sumptuous, however take care of your cholesterol levels after you have it. I recommend to have this at least once and strive for another day only on salads to get back your cholesterol levels. The chicken they use are baby chicken which is high in protein, and they make a fry out of it using coconut oil (mostly used in Kerala) which gives out a fine taste. The real gesture comes on your face, the moment you feel the smell of the frying chicken in the pan. The seasoning which they use before frying the chicken is unque of its kind and it is a non-reproducible stuff in your kitchen. The fry is hot, however in my words, it is that hot taste which grabs you towards it, just like the sweetness you feel while you have finished a gooseberry.
Afternoon Speciality
Every afternoon you would have an opportunity to enjoy this wonderful chicken along with Ghee Rice (made out of boiled white rice sauted in ghee, garnished with dry fruits). For those who are health conscious can make use of Chapathi (pan cake made out of wheat flour). Lunch is served along with a curry made out the chicken parts, along with Lemon Pickle (made out of lime and salt which is preserved for weeks/months) and lemon juice. The lemon pickle is considered to be a home remedy for stomach disorders, and locally considered to reduce the heaviness you feel while having a big meal.
Evening Speciality
As the sun goes down to dusk, appetite rides over our heart and soul. A perfect combination of food would guide you warm and comfort sleep. Unlike other societies who take less of dinner, than the breakfast, our land has a good habit of a full-filled dinner. This place is unique for those who really enjoys a heavy dinner. you don’t get much choice here, other than the Chicken specialty and the Chapathis served with chicken curry, lemon pickle and lemon juice. But this will really make you feel the richness of having a good tasty dinner.
Talking about ambiance is the last and final thing I would like to share with you all. This place is a zero ambiance restaurant, where food is served in palm leaves and at times you can hear the lame cry of those wonderful chickens who are awaiting their turn in your mouth. However, these are the standards they follow, so if you feel like going in for a wonderful food, with a good appetite, just try it.
